Financial experts research stocks, bonds, companies, and markets to assist bankers, investors, and business financing officers with mergers, acquisitions, and stock/bond offerings, as well as corporate expansions and restructuring. They can take advantage of their finance significant training as they dissect financial statements and other financial information. Monetary experts construct monetary designs and conduct complicated quantitative analyses.
According to the BLS, financial experts earn a typical income of $81,590, and jobs are predicted to grow at a faster than typical rate of 5% through 2029. Financing majors with strong writing, organizational, and interaction skills can thrive in this role. Spending plan experts apply concepts of financing to tasks and proposals in the organization, educational, governmental, and not-for-profit sectors. They evaluate budget plans and examine the financial effect of continuing endeavors and new ventures.

Credit experts examine the financial standing of loan prospects and evaluate the dangers included with offering them funding.

Attorneys in numerous locations of practice, consisting of divorce, product liability, civil litigation, business, labor, and securities law, benefit from a knowledge of financing. Lawyers who investigate monetary abnormalities should read and comprehend financial statements. Attorneys in civil cases need the skills to approximate proper compensation for settlements. Research and analytical skills established by financing majors enable lawyers to prepare their cases.
According to the BLS, lawyers earn an average salary of $122,960, and jobs are predicted to grow by about 4% through 2029.
